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Lochwinnoch to Whalley (Lancs) start from as little as £14.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Lochwinnoch to Whalley (Lancs) start from £73.50 one way, or £105.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Lochwinnoch to Whalley (Lancs) are available for £74.90 one way, or £149.80 return

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Lochwinnoch is a station that embraces simplicity and functionality. Although there is no ticket office, the station offers accessible ticket machines for collecting pre-purchased tickets and purchasing new ones. Do note, smartcards are not issued here, but validators are available for convenience. For accessibility, the station is categorized as a Category B station. There's level access to Platform 1, while Platform 2 is accessible via stairs, so take care to plan your route accordingly.

Even though there are no staff on hand for assistance, customer help points and an induction loop are available, ensuring passengers can travel with ease. Luggage storage and ramp access for trains are missing, so it's best to pack lightly and if you have limited mobility, to plan ahead by booking assistance through services like Passenger Assist.

Parking and Cycling Amenities

If you’re driving to the station, you'll find the car parking facilities are open 24/7, boasting a total of 17 spaces including one for Blue Badge holders. And for those who prefer cycling, 10 sheltered bicycle spaces await you, although bike hire isn't available at the station.

Facilities at Whalley (Lancs) Train Station

While the station may be limited in amenities, it remains quite practical for travelers. There's no traditional ticket office, but you can collect your pre-booked tickets from the available machines. However, please note the machines are not accessible, which might require prior arrangement if needed. The station does not boast the luxury of wa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, so grabbing a coffee beforehand might be a good idea. The car park, operated by Northern Rail, is open 24/7 offering free parking, but it does have a limited number of spaces.

Accessibility is a consideration here; step-free access is only available toward the Manchester-bound platform, while those needing access to the Clitheroe platform will encounter steps. For those needing assistance, you can take advantage of the Passenger Assist services, with boarding ramps present on all trains, enabling a more accommodating travel experience.
